Microwave Christmas Pudding - RECIPE
Christmas Pudding is a traditional Christmas dessert. This microwave version is a quick and easy substitute for the traditional boiled / steamed pudding, but tastes just as good as the original - give it a go!

Bread Sauce - CHRISTMAS RECIPE
Bread Sauce is a traditional Christmas sauce that is very easy to make. Milk is infused with onion and spices, then mixed with fresh breadcrumbs to create a thick, savoury sauce. Serve hot or cold, as a gravy or a condiment, this delicious sauce will add that extra taste of Christmas to your table - give it a go!

Creamy Egg Nog - CHRISTMAS RECIPE
Creamy Egg Nog is a traditional Christmas drink made with fresh eggs, milk, cream and a little bit of brandy. Lightly spiced with seasonal spices, this delicious drink can be served warm or chilled, with or without alcohol - give it a go!

Fruit Mince Pies - CHRISTMAS RECIPE
Fruit Mince Pies are a traditional festive treat and an essential for any Christmas celebration. Dried Fruit is combined with brandy, brown sugar, citrus zest and grated apple. The fruit mince is enveloped in home made sweet shortcrust pastry and baked until golden. These gorgeous pies will be a big hit - give it a go!

Mini Beef Wellingtons - RECIPE
Mini Beef Wellingtons can be served as a party snack or as part of a main meal. Succulent pieces of beef are seared and wrapped in a layer of puff pastry with a savoury mixture of mushroom, onion and garlic. Baked until golden and puffed, these amazing little morsels will have your guests begging you for the recipe - give it a go!

Chocolate Pear Pudding - RECIPE
Chocolate Pear Pudding is a wonderful baked dessert using basic, everyday ingredients. Canned pears are drained and arranged in a baking dish, then topped with a thick, smooth chocolate cake batter and baked until hot and spongy. Served with freshly whipped cream, this is perfect for last minute desserts or when you want to jazz up boring old tinned fruit - give it a go!
